New EC Project: Optimal Strategies for Climate Change Action in Rural Areas (OSCAR)
A new project started in January 2012, funded by the European Commission (DG CLIMA), to explore ways to optimally design climate change policies via the EU’s rural development programme.
The project will involve evaluating rural development measures and operations using Life Cycle Assessment (LCA) coupled with an Adaptive Capacity Impact Assessment (ACIA) on ecosystem services. This will provide an assessment of their potential benefits for climate change mitigation and adaptation, impacts on productivity and identify any practicality issues associated with their implementation.
This information will be used to develop an RDP manual and checklist to facilitate the optimisation of national rural development programmes to support the delivery of climate policy objectives. The project will involve stakeholder engagement and consultation (e.g. to define end user requirements for the manual and checklist) at national and regional levels across Europe.
The project will conclude with a workshop in Brussels at the end of 2012.
